Structural sizing and performance are presented for two structural concepts for an aerobrake hexagonal heat shield panel. One concept features a sandwich construction with an aluminum honeycomb core and thin quasi-isotropic graphite-epoxy face sheets. The other concept features a skin-rib isogrid construction with thin quasi-isotropic graphite-epoxy skins and graphite-epoxy ribs oriented at 0, ]60, and -60 degs along the panel. Linear static, linear bifurcation buckling, and nonlinear static analyses were performed to compare the structural performance of the two panel concepts and assess their feasibility for a lunar transfer vehicle aerobrake application.
